


BNSF celebrates the 250th: the GE ES44ACM by ScaleTrains' Rivet Counter line recreates BNSF's three commemorative “America 250” units, renumbered 250, 1776 and 2026, in their brand-new patriotic scheme.
What sets this model apart is Rivet Counter's signature prototype fidelity. In 2002, GE released the first GEVO, the series destined to replace the AC4400CW and Dash 9 and meet EPA emissions standards; powered by the GEVO-12 engine, the ES44 has become the best-selling diesel locomotive of all time. BNSF's ES44ACMs (3282-3381 series, built January 2026) are new-build ES44ACH units, the “H” denoting heavy ballasting for increased tractive effort. Former BNSF 3379-3381 were renumbered 250, 1776 and 2026 to mark the United States' 250th anniversary.
This DCC and sound version comes with a factory-installed ESU LokSound 5 decoder with Full Throttle and all the prototype-specific detailing the Rivet Counter line is known for.
Features
- GE ES44ACM (ES44ACH) “GEVO” diesel-electric locomotive, 4,400 hp, six-axle (C-C)
- Commemorative BNSF “America 250” scheme; road numbers offered: 250, 1776 and 2026 (ex-BNSF 3379-3381)
- Premium Rivet Counter line from ScaleTrains
- Factory-installed ESU LokSound 5 DCC and sound decoder with Full Throttle
- LED lighting: directional headlights, ditch lights, front, rear and side walkway lights, lighted number boards
- Detailed cab interior with grade crossing camera
- GE Hi-Ad trucks with reinforcement plating
- Semi-scale metal Type E knuckle couplers
- All-wheel drive and pickup
- Minimum radius 18" (22" recommended)
- Era: 2026 to present
- HO scale
- Made by ScaleTrains
